What is Landlord-Tenant Attorney?

A landlord-tenant attorney specializes in residential and commercial rental disputes under California law. These disputes range from evictions and lease violations to habitability claims, security deposit recovery, and rent disputes. California has some of the nation's most tenant-friendly laws, including strong anti-eviction protections and strict habitability standards. Without proper legal representation, landlords may face costly procedural errors in eviction cases, while tenants risk losing rights to damages or wrongful eviction claims. Your attorney ensures compliance with California Civil Code requirements, proper notice procedures, and fair resolution whether you're seeking recovery, lease enforcement, or tenant removal.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How long does a landlord-tenant case take in Los Angeles County?

A: Eviction timelines in LA County typically range from 60–120 days, depending on tenant response and court schedules. Uncontested cases move faster; contested cases may extend to six months. Your attorney can explain your specific timeline based on the Stanley Mosk Courthouse's current docket and your case type.

Q: Do I need to appear in court for a landlord-tenant dispute?

A: Most cases require at least one court appearance. However, many disputes settle before trial through negotiation or mediation. Your attorney can represent you in most proceedings and advise whether your physical presence is necessary for hearings at Stanley Mosk Courthouse.

Q: What documents do I need for a landlord-tenant case?

A: Essential documents include the lease agreement, proof of service (notices), rent payment records, photographs of property conditions, and any written communication with the other party. The LA County Registrar-Recorder maintains property records. Your attorney will advise on additional documentation needed for your specific claim.

Q: Can I handle a landlord-tenant dispute myself in California?

A: While possible, California's complex tenant protections and strict procedural rules make self-representation risky. One procedural error can derail your case entirely. An experienced Irwindale attorney knows LA County court procedures and protects your rights far more effectively than DIY approaches.

Q: What happens if I don't follow California's eviction procedures?

A: Improper eviction procedures can result in case dismissal, liability for damages, attorney fees, and wrongful eviction claims. California courts strictly enforce notice requirements and service rules. Your attorney ensures full compliance with state law and local Stanley Mosk Courthouse requirements.
